The Integrations module in Zeroplat allows you to connect your applications with databases, APIs, external services, and hosted environments seamlessly. It acts as the backbone of your applications by enabling smooth communication between different systems, tools, and services.
With Integrations, you can:
- Connect to popular databases such as MS SQL, PostgreSQL, MySQL, and SQLite.
- Consume and expose APIs for real-time data exchange and automation.
- Extend functionality with JavaScript logic (variables, transformers, and queries).
- Leverage Zeroplat Hosted services like built-in email sending or cloud integrations.
Key Features
🔹 Database Connections
Easily integrate your apps with relational databases. Manage data directly through resources and use queries to build dynamic applications.
🔹 API Integrations
Connect with REST APIs, third-party services, or internal endpoints. Send and receive data securely to create fully automated workflows.
🔹 JavaScript Extensions
Add business logic and custom transformations using JavaScript. Build advanced features such as variable handling, transformers, and JS-based queries.
🔹 Zeroplat Hosted Services
Use out-of-the-box integrations like SMTP email sending or cloud hosting options provided by Zeroplat.
🔹 Environment Management
Define multiple environments (Development, Test, Production) to ensure smooth deployment cycles with consistent integrations.
